4.0 out of 5 stars The game has changed. Learn the new zone attack., 5 Mar 1999
By A Customer
Beat the zone by creating triangles and passing was how it was taught in my day. Today you'll see the same fundamentals enhanced with picks, back picks, and gap dribbling... heresy 25 years ago. This book teaches the new concepts that are essential to coaching today. I read it cover to cover and now use it as an important reference.

4.0 out of 5 stars if you are an X's and O's technician - great book!, 20 Dec 1998
By A Customer
The book has many many zone offenses. Some against specific zones and some good for any zone. They are mostly continuities. Very detailed descriptions for each offense, very thorough and effective. I adopted one zone offense for my 8th grade team and achieved immediate results.

"Attacking Zone Defenses(second edition)," by John Kresse provides sophisticated basketball principles for basketball thoroughbreds. This three part book is comprehensive and well written...it is also very motivational. However, in my opinion part one...which includes chapters on; basic principles, rules to win by; the balanced machine; and planning each trip downcourt can help teams that are 13-years old and under.

Parts two and three are outstanding but geared much more for coaches who have experienced players who have a strong knowledge of the game and who have developed advanced basketball skills. Nevertheless, this is a valuable book for all AAU or high school coachs who want a frame by frame breakdown of the 2-1-2, 2-3, 1-2-2, 3-2 and 1-3-1 defensive zones. Coach Kresse is a very talented coach and provides solid instructions on how to teach great execution.

Kresse played for and coached with legendary New York basketball coaches Joe Lapchick and Lou Carnesecca at St. Johns University and also with the New York Nets of the American Basketball Association. And although Coach Kresse has a rich basketball history he teaches many new generation techniques. Overall, this book presents good ideas for a successful basketball program. Recommended.
